Explain Adverse effects of Indinavir
In addition to adverse effects similar to those of other protease inhibitors, indinavir causes elevation of indirect bilirubin, indinavir-containing kidney stones and renal insufficiency, dermato- logic changes including alopecia, dry skin and mucous membranes, and paronychia and ingrown toenails. Patients should drink at least 1.5-2 liters of water daily to minimize renal adverse effects. Gallstones have also been reported.
